Aspen Technology (AZPN) recently announced that Omaha Public Power District (“OPPD”) will be leveraging its cutting-edge Digital Grid Management (DGM) to achieve net zero carbon production by 2050. OPPD will leverage the DGM suite to monitor, schedule and optimize the performance of their energy assets while maintaining grid reliability. Corporate Transactions and Partnerships - The transaction between AspenTech and Emerson Electric Co. was completed on May 16, 2022, with a change in fiscal year end from September 30 to June 30 starting fiscal year 2022[7]. - The partnership with Emerson Electric Co. aims to identify cross-selling opportunities and expand into new markets, including pharmaceuticals and green hydrogen[58][59]. - AspenTech's partnership with Emerson includes both OEM and joint solution development, enhancing opportunities for portfolio expansion[75]. Energy Transition and Sustainability - Global energy investment is projected to exceed $3 trillion in 2024, with $2 trillion allocated for clean energy technologies and infrastructure[16]. - The International Energy Agency forecasts a potential 40-fold increase in lithium demand and a 25-fold increase in cobalt demand by 2040 due to electrification and energy transition[20]. - The United Nations Climate Change convention COP28 aims to double energy efficiency improvements and triple renewable energy capacity by 2030[18]. - AspenTech is collaborating with Saudi Aramco to develop a new integrated modeling and optimization solution for CCUS decision-making and sustainability strategy investments[24]. - The company is focused on building partner ecosystems to enhance energy transition strategies and innovate on sustainability pathways[23]. - AspenTech has developed several sustainability pathways to assist customers in energy transition and decarbonization, optimizing for economics and reliability[82]. - The company’s sustainability strategy focuses on reducing emissions and advancing diversity, equity, and inclusion within its workforce[39]. Digitalization and Automation - The company emphasizes the importance of digitalization and automation to support operational excellence amid a generational workforce transition, with over 45% of industry personnel expected to retire between 2025 and 2027[22]. - The company introduced the latest version of aspenONE, V14.3, in May 2024, enhancing planning and scheduling capabilities with Industrial AI for higher optimization levels[37]. - The Industrial Data Fabric, acquired from inmation Software GmbH in August 2022, supports data management across product suites, enabling operational data lakes for better data security and integration[46]. Financial Performance and Revenue Model - The company’s revenue model primarily consists of software licenses and maintenance contracts, with a focus on transitioning the Digital Grid Management suite to a term software model for predictable cash flows[47][48]. - The company utilizes key financial metrics such as Annual Contract Value (ACV) and Total Contract Value (TCV) to assess business performance, alongside non-GAAP metrics like Free Cash Flow[52]. - The sales and marketing team comprised 876 employees as of June 30, 2024, focusing on strategic engagement with asset-intensive industries[55]. - The software maintenance and support service includes access to over 30,000 knowledge base articles as of June 30, 2024, enhancing customer support and satisfaction[63]. Workforce and Training - AspenTech University trains approximately 17,000 individuals annually through over 1,800 classes, including 20 courses focused on sustainability[66]. - As of June 30, 2024, there were 1,187 employees in customer support, professional services, and training groups[68]. - The Emerging Leaders Program has seen over half of its participants promoted since 2018, improving employee retention[94]. - As of June 30, 2024, AspenTech had 3,937 employees globally, with 1,821 located in the United States[89][95]. Market Challenges and Risks - The competitive landscape includes large global industrial automation companies and start-ups, some of which may have greater resources than AspenTech[105]. - The company faces challenges in increasing product adoption and usage across its five product suites, which is critical for its growth strategy[143]. - Economic uncertainty and reduced demand in asset-intensive industries could adversely affect the company's operating results[150]. - The ongoing Israeli-Hamas conflict may lead to reduced capital expenditures from customers in the region, adversely affecting sales[136]. - The company faces significant climate-related transition risks that may adversely affect its business and financial condition due to the need to adapt to decarbonization and electrification efforts[152]. - New legal and regulatory requirements related to ESG measures may increase operating expenses and expose the company to potential liabilities and reputational damage[155]. Cybersecurity and Data Privacy - Cybersecurity threats and data privacy breaches pose risks to the company's operations, potentially leading to significant revenue loss and increased costs for protection measures[175]. - Cybersecurity incidents could lead to significant financial loss, reputational damage, and increased costs for cybersecurity protection and remediation[179]. Foreign Operations and Currency Risks - A significant portion of the company's revenue is derived from operations outside the United States, making it vulnerable to various foreign risks, including regulatory changes and economic instability[130]. - Approximately 14.0%, 9.0%, and 17.0% of total revenue for the twelve months ended June 30, 2024, 2023, and the nine months ended June 30, 2022, respectively, was denominated in currencies other than the U.S. dollar[328]. - Net foreign currency exchange losses were recorded at $9.1 million, $4.1 million, and $(0.3) million for the twelve months ended June 30, 2024, 2023, and the nine months ended June 30, 2022, respectively[329]. Strategic Transactions and Integration - The integration of Heritage AspenTech, DGM, and SSE businesses may face challenges that could delay anticipated benefits[110]. - Transaction-related costs incurred during the integration of DGM and SSE businesses may reduce expected cost synergies in the near term[112]. - Strategic transactions, such as acquisitions, may disrupt operations and dilute shareholder value, with risks including unanticipated costs and challenges in integration[162]. Intellectual Property and Competition - The company holds 430 issued patents and pending patent applications worldwide as of June 30, 2024[97]. - Intellectual property infringement claims could result in substantial costs and damage to the company's business, as defending such claims can be time-consuming and expensive[168]. - The competitive landscape is challenging, with established vendors and new entrants potentially offering lower prices and better products, which could pressure the company's margins[157].

Core Insights - Aspen Technology reported revenue of $342.91 million for the quarter ended June 2024, marking a year-over-year increase of 6.9% and an EPS of $2.37 compared to $2.13 a year ago [1] - The revenue exceeded the Zacks Consensus Estimate of $315.45 million by 8.70%, while the EPS surpassed the consensus estimate of $2.08 by 13.94% [1] Revenue Breakdown - Maintenance revenue was $89.17 million, exceeding the estimated $86.96 million, reflecting a year-over-year increase of 7.9% [3] - Services and other revenue reached $22.74 million, significantly higher than the estimated $15.85 million, representing a substantial year-over-year increase of 49.8% [4] - License and solutions revenue totaled $231 million, surpassing the average estimate of $212.64 million, with a year-over-year change of 3.7% [5] Stock Performance - Aspen Technology's shares have declined by 13.1% over the past month, compared to a 6.7% decline in the Zacks S&P 500 composite [5] - The stock currently holds a Zacks Rank 3 (Hold), suggesting it may perform in line with the broader market in the near term [5]
